技术文摘
H5与小程序交互设计的区别
2025-01-09 11:52:36 小编
H5 与小程序交互设计的区别
在移动互联网快速发展的当下,H5 和小程序都成为了开发者和企业常用的工具,它们在交互设计方面存在着诸多显著差异。
从加载速度来看,小程序有着明显优势。小程序基于微信、支付宝等平台,通过预先将部分代码包下载到本地,用户再次使用时加载速度极快。而 H5 页面每次访问都需从服务器加载资源,在网络不稳定时,加载时间较长,容易导致用户流失。这就使得小程序在交互的流畅性初始环节领先一步。
操作便捷性上,两者各有特点。小程序通常有固定的入口,如微信小程序下拉菜单,用户能快速找到并打开。其交互操作接近原生应用,支持多种手势操作,如滑动、点击等,给用户带来熟悉且便捷的体验。H5 页面则需通过浏览器或在其他应用内打开链接进入,操作流程相对复杂。不过,H5 可以借助浏览器的功能,如分享、收藏等,在特定场景下也有便利之处。
在功能丰富度方面,小程序由于依托强大的平台生态,能调用平台的各种能力,如定位、支付、摄像头等,实现较为复杂的功能,为用户提供更全面的交互体验。H5 虽然也能实现一些功能,但在调用系统底层功能时会受到浏览器的限制,部分复杂功能实现起来难度较大,交互效果相对受限。
视觉呈现上,H5 页面设计更加灵活多样,不受特定框架约束,设计师可以充分发挥创意,打造出极具个性化和视觉冲击力的页面。小程序则遵循平台的设计规范,视觉风格相对统一,以保证在不同设备和场景下的稳定性和一致性,但在个性化设计上稍显不足。
H5 和小程序在交互设计上的区别明显。开发者需要根据项目的具体需求、目标用户群体以及使用场景等因素,合理选择合适的技术方案,以提供最佳的用户交互体验,满足用户不断变化的需求。
- JSP 获取 WEB.XML 中定义的参数
- XML 文档搜索使用心得
- HTML 中 XML 数据岛的记录编辑及添加
- XML 于语音合成的应用
- XML、DataSet 与 DataGrid 的结合(二)
- 基于 Flash 和 XML 构建聊天室
- Fckeditor 实现图片上传至独立图片服务器的办法
- 国产免费 HTML 在线编辑器 xhEditor
- Asp 与 XML 的交互实现
- CKEditor SyntaxHighlighter 代码高亮插件完美修复
- 解决 asp.net+FCKeditor 上传图片显示叉叉无法显示的问题
- Autogrow:使 FCKeditor 高度随内容增长的插件
- 常用网页编辑器漏洞全面手册:fckeditor、ewebeditor
- FCKeditorAPI 手册:JS 操作与获取
- FCK 对内容是否为空的判断(仅去空格的方式有误)